Peter Handscomb hits career-best 281*

Victoria versus Western Australia In what ended up being a draw on a level surface, the last day was overwhelmed by a magnificent execution from Peter Handscomb. The Victoria skipper, who was batting for the time being on 174, scored a profession best 281* and added 316 for the fifth wicket with Sam Harper (132*) as Victoria mounted a score of 616/4 dec. WA needed to bat out 66 overs with a deficiency of 150 and it looked troublesome when Murphy, the youthful off-spinner, decreased them to 13/2 yet Hilton Cartwright (76*) and D'Arcy Short (39*) saw their side to a draw. Brief Scores: Western Australia 466 & 185/5 (Cartwright 76*; Murphy 3-42) drew with Victoria (Handscomb 281*, Harper 132*; Hardie 2-88)
